Navigating customs and restricted items

While Hong Kong is generally a duty-free port for most consumer electronics, it is vital to stay informed about import tax regulations. You can find detailed information on customs tax policies by visiting the section on import duties. Most laptop purchases will not incur heavy taxes, but it is always better to verify before the package arrives at the border.

Furthermore, ensure that your shipment does not contain any restricted goods. High-capacity batteries, which are central to the Framework Laptop, must be handled according to specific shipping rules. Review the list of prohibited items to ensure that all components of your DIY kit are eligible for air travel. Most standard laptop batteries are fine when contained within the equipment, but loose spare batteries may require extra attention.
